How to remove burnt stains from microwave

Many people are faced with the unappealing smell of burning food from their microwave ovens. In most cases, the smell often lingers for a few days. In worst cases, there are even burn marks on the interior of your microwave oven.

These burn marks can be a challenge to remove since certain cleaning products can damage the microwave oven further or even taint your food.

How do you get tough stains out of a microwave?

Most times you can remove burnt stains from the microwave by first using some warm water and dish soap. Afterward, you need some baking soda. Another solution is heating vinegar or lemon juice with water for 2-5 mins in the microwave.

Steps on how to remove burnt stains from microwave

If you discover burnt stains on your microwave oven, you should deal with them right away. Let’s take a look at the steps on how to remove burnt stains from microwave.

  • Prepare a solution by mixing warm water and dish soap in a bowl until suds form. Saturate a sponge or rag into the mixture and rub on burned-on food or food stains. You can use a coarser pad if needed.
  • Moisten a rag or cloth with warm water and sprinkle baking soda onto the rag. Scrub on stubborn burnt stains. 
  • Prepare a paste by mixing 3 parts baking soda to 1-part water. Apply the paste over burnt stains and let it sit for 3-4 minutes. Wipe clean with a moist rag or sponge to get rid of stubborn burnt stains.

How to get rid of burn marks on your microwave oven

When dealing with burn marks on your microwave oven, simply follow these steps.

  • Moisten a soft rag or cotton ball with acetone nail polish remover.
  • Scrub on the burn marks until they are removed. 
  • Clean the interior of your microwave oven with warm water and dish soap to prevent any lingering cleaner from tainting your food.

How do I clean the microwave after burning foil?

There are instances when foil ends up burned in your microwave oven. Simply follow these steps to clean your microwave oven properly.

  • Sprinkle baking soda in the interior of your microwave oven and rub using a moist cloth. Wipe clean with a damp cloth or towel.
  • Prepare a solution with a 1:8 ratio of vinegar and water and microwave until it boils. Let it sit in the microwave for 15 minutes and wipe down with a moist cloth.
  • When removing scorch marks, soak a clean cloth with nail polish remover. Wipe the site clean with a moist cloth after. 
  • In a bowl that contains some water, add some instant coffee powder. Microwave until the odor of the nail polish remover is gone. 

What gets rid of burnt smoke smell?

If your microwave oven emits a burnt smoke odor, it can be a challenging ordeal for most. Luckily, you can get rid of the burnt smoke smell with the following tips.

  • Fill a small bowl or basin with ½ cup water and add a tablespoon of white vinegar. Microwave it for 4-5 minutes and let it sit with the door closed for 10-15 minutes. The steam will loosen the residue responsible for the burnt smoke odor. Vinegar will absorb the burnt odor. After a while, remove the bowl or basin and wipe the interior of the microwave with paper towels.
  • Saturate a sponge with vinegar and sprinkle some baking soda on top of it. Microwave the sponge up to 25 seconds. Wipe the interior of the microwave with the sponge including the tray and microwave door. 
  • Use an acetone-free nail polish remover to wipe down the interior of the microwave oven. Wipe the interior with soap followed by vinegar water to remove the polish remover. 
  • Peel two oranges or a slice a lemon in half. Add the orange peels or lemon slices in a bowl of water. Microwave for 4 minutes. Leave the bowl inside the microwave oven for 12 hours. 
  • Place a box of baking soda inside your microwave oven overnight. This works by neutralizing the odor. Another option is to place coffee grounds in a bowl in the microwave throughout the day.

How do you remove burnt stains from microwave without vinegar?

If you are faced with burnt stains on your microwave and do not have any vinegar available, there are other methods that you can use. 

Before trying out any of these cleaning methods, you must first unplug the power cord. This is also the right time to check the cord for any damage or dirt. Inspect the interior of your microwave to determine the dirtiest areas. Let’s take a look at some of the cleaning methods that you can use.

  • Moist paper towels. A quick method to clean your microwave oven is to position several moist paper towels within and set the oven on high power up to 5 minutes. The steam from the towels will relax and loosen any caked-on burnt stains. When the towels cool down, you can wipe them on the interior.
  • Baking soda. Any burnt stains or spills on the floor or turntable of your microwave oven can be removed by preparing a paste by mixing 2 parts baking soda to one part water. Apply on the solidified areas and let it sit for up to 5 minutes. Wipe with a damp sponge or cloth and remove any leftover residue with a paper towel.
  • Lemon juice. Slice a lemon in half and place both halves cut-side down on the microwave plate. Add a tablespoon of water. Microwave for up to a minute or until the lemon is hot and the interior of the oven is steamy. Wipe down the interior using clean paper towels. 
  • Dish soap. Fill a microwave-safe bowl with warm water. Pour a sufficient amount of dishwashing soap. Place the bowl in the microwave for up to a minute or until it starts to steam and remove it. Moisten a sponge and wipe the interior of the microwave. The steam loosens all the burnt up residue. You can also include baking soda into the mixture since it works as a deodorizer.
  • A diluted solution of window cleaner. In a bowl, combine 2 parts window cleaner with one part water. Saturate a sponge into the solution and wipe the interior. For stubborn burnt residue, let it sit for 5 minutes before scrubbing. Use a clean rag that is dipped in clean water to rinse away the solution. 
  • Commercial cleaners. Various types of commercial cleaners can clean just about any stains in your microwave, but some leave behind unpleasant fumes. If you are going to use a commercial cleaner, go for a scent-free variant.
